I have a pageable container under "Customer Feedback" on the homepage of the provided URL (it's set to autoplay). If you scroll past it so it's out of view, the next time it switches slides automatically, the page automatically scrolls up to the point where you can see half of that section. How can this be fixed?

Thanks for responding back! Upon checking in Chrome browser, we are not able to reproduce the same issue at our end. You may try out the following:
– Try using different browser (Chrome, Firefox, Edge). – Try using “Chrome incognito” mode, (by pressing CTRL+SHIFT+N) while using Chrome. – If you have an Antivirus installed, try deactivating it for a while and re-check this issue.
You are actually using an old version of our theme too (1.9.4.1) and the latest version for the moment is (1.9.4.2), please update your theme first and then the premium plugins too.
The easiest way to update our themes is if you use Envato Toolkit or Envato Market plugin. On this link How to update Themes and Plugins you can learn this easy step-by-step procedure :)
If you are using Envato Market plugin to update your theme, just follow this little procedure http://drops.laborator.co/pLFH
Important: After you update the theme please don't forget to go to Appearance > Install Plugins to update all your premium plugins to the latest version that we support.
If you can't update LayerSlider, go to Plugins and deactivate this plugin. Then go to Appearance > Install Plugins, you now can update and then activate Layer Slider again.
Every single time I try to do the Envato Market auto-update, it never works, and this time was no different.
Something has changed since you wrote that blog, because the screenshots do not look the same. They only ask for the API key (not marketplace username), and the API key under Settings does not work.... And there is no tab that says "Themes" either.
Aside from the Envato problem, I updated the theme and Visual Composer and that solved the problem. I would still like to know why the Envato market never works
